Seaport Entertainment Group Inc.
A hospitality and entertainment real-estate company that owns the historic Seaport District in Lower Manhattan, runs the rooftop concert venue at Pier 17, and fields the Las Vegas Aviators Triple-A baseball team at Las Vegas Ballpark. It was spun off from Howard Hughes Holdings in July 2024, taking its name from the centuries-old maritime waterfront it stewards. Its Las Vegas baseball team is named for the aviation-loving Howard Hughes, founder of the parent company.
